Construction Manager Salary in Connecticut

The median construction manager salary in Connecticut is $113,658 per year, which is 12.0% above the national median of $101,480.

Construction Manager Salary in Connecticut by Experience

In Connecticut, an entry-level construction manager earns around $69,440, while experienced professionals earn up to $184,800 per year. The cost of living index in Connecticut is 112% of the national average.
